Abstract

The utility model relates to machining equipment of a neodymium-iron-boron magnetic body, in particular to a neodymium-iron-boron magnetic body center-less grinding guiding wheel device. The problem that a blank is broken because of direct mutual squeezing of the neodymium-iron-boron blank and a guiding wheel is solved. According to the technical scheme, the neodymium-iron-boron magnetic body center-less grinding guiding wheel device comprises a guiding track, a diamond grinding wheel and a guiding wheel. The diamond grinding wheel and the guiding wheel are arranged on two sides of the guiding track and grind the neodymium-iron-boron magnetic body on the guiding track. Rubber materials with elasticity are arranged on the outer periphery face where the guiding wheel and the neodymium-iron-boron magnetic body are in contact. The neodymium-iron-boron magnetic body center-less grinding guiding wheel device has the advantages that a rubber material layer with elasticity is arranged on the outer periphery contacting face of the center-less grinding guiding wheel, the problems of breaking caused by collision of the neodymium-iron-boron magnetic body, the grinding wheel and the guiding wheel are reduced, a material pressing block is arranged at the upper end of the guiding track, so that the neodymium-iron-boron magnetic body to be machined is firmly fixed, and the phenomenon that a piece to be machined moves and flies out during a grinding wheel high-speed grinding process is effectively avoided.

Background technology
Sintered NdFeB is the strongest permanent magnet of contemporary magnetic, and it not only has advantages such as high remanent magnetism, high-coercive force, high energy product, high performance-price ratio, and is processed into various sizes easily, is specially adapted to the electronic product of various high-performance, miniaturization, lightness.
In recent years, owing to be the fast development of the high-tech industry of representative with the information industry, more and more higher requirement has been proposed for the performance of ferro-aluminum boron.
The blank that neodymium iron boron powder metallurgical technology is produced, because sintering shrinks, cylindrical is yielding, and size difference is bigger, and grinding allowance is big, needs to process grinding with centerless grinder.Centerless grinder is not need to adopt the axle center of workpiece and a class grinding machine of implementing grinding.Be by abrasive grinding wheel, three mechanisms of guide wheel and work support constitute the wherein actual work of serving as grinding of abrasive grinding wheel, the rotation of guide wheel control workpiece, and make workpiece generation feed velocity, and be supporting workpiece when the grinding as for work support, these three kinds of parts can multiple cooperation carry out grinding.
The processing of original centreless grinding with guide wheel mainly usefulness be harder artificial stone material, when the bigger cylinder of mill diameter, because guide wheel is harder, not good small column for perpendicularity, be easy to produce fracture owing to mutual extrusion makes the neodymium iron boron small column, cause the defective of production.
The utility model content
For solving the defective that exists in the above-mentioned prior art, the utility model provides a kind of neodymium iron boron magnetic body centreless grinding guide wheel device, has solved neodymium iron boron blank and guide wheel produce the blank fracture owing to mutual extrusion problem.
Technical solutions of the utility model are for providing a kind of neodymium iron boron centreless grinding guide wheel device, comprise guide rail, skive and guide wheel, described skive and guide wheel are arranged at the neodymium iron boron magnetic body on guide rail both sides and the grinding slideway, and the outer peripheral face that described guide wheel contacts with neodymium iron boron magnetic body is provided with rubber-like elastomeric material layer.
Preferably, in the above-mentioned neodymium iron boron centreless grinding guide wheel device, described guide rail top is provided with binder block, the top of described binder block fixedly connected slidably binder block slide.
Preferably, in the above-mentioned neodymium iron boron centreless grinding guide wheel device, the quantity of described skive is 2.
Preferably, in the above-mentioned neodymium iron boron centreless grinding guide wheel device, described guide rail surface is provided with the elastic caoutchouc projection.
The utlity model has following remarkable advantages and beneficial effect: the periphery contact-making surface of centreless grinding guide wheel of the present utility model arranges the rubber-like elastomeric material, reduce neodymium iron boron magnetic body and emery wheel and magnet and guide wheel and collided caused breakage problem, improved the qualification rate of product greatly, binder block is set in the guide rail upper end makes neodymium iron boron magnetic body to be processed obtain firm fixing, effectively avoid to be processed the phenomenon that flies out that in emery wheel high-speed grinding process, walks to take place, guarantee operating personnel's personal safety, and improved the qualification rate of workpiece.
